Verena has more than twenty years of classroom experience at the elementary and middle school levels. She has been teaching written language, reading, and spelling in regular and special education settings. Since completing her intervention program, Verena gives workshops at educational conferences and in school districts. Her volunteer work includes teaching adults who are English Language Learners.
This program uses a multisensory approach involving the visual, auditory, kinesthetic (motion of writing), and oral (speaking) modalities. Multisensory principles activate every student's stronger learning style and strengthen the weaker modality.
While working as a Resource Specialist, a district committee selected Verena to Mentor Teacher positions three different years to develop reading lessons for struggling readers and to provide workshops for regular and special education staff. Power Tools for Literacy is the culmination of her work as a Mentor Teacher.
Verena has a B.A. in English from the University of California at Berkeley and an M.A. in Education of Learning Disabled Children from Minnesota State University.
